How they compare

United Republic of Tanzania currently reports 83,827 kg against 74,452 kg in India, a difference of 9,375 kg.

That makes United Republic of Tanzania's figure about 1.1 times India's.

The two have swapped places 1 time across 63 shared years of data; in 1961 it was India ahead.

India ranks 28th and United Republic of Tanzania ranks 8th of 120 countries.

India has averaged higher in every one of the 7 decades both report.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
